Section: Understanding torrenting and VPN basics Brave vpn kosten was du wirklich zahlen musst und ob es sich lohnt

  • What is torrenting? A method to share files using a decentralized network, often used for large public-domain or legitimate software distributions but also used for copyrighted content.
  • Why use a VPN for torrenting? To hide your IP from peers and trackers, encrypt traffic, and reduce exposure to ISPs that throttle or monitor P2P activity.
  • How VPNs help with privacy and security:
    • Encrypts traffic to your ISP and potential observers
    • Masks your real IP from peers, trackers, and websites
    • Helps prevent certain types of network eavesdropping on public Wi-Fi
  • Important caveats:
    • VPNs don’t legalize illegal activity; you’re still bound by local laws
    • Some ISPs may still investigate or throttle even when using a VPN
    • Not all VPNs perform well with P2P due to server load, port restrictions, or protocol shaping

Section: Norton VPN’s policy on torrenting and P2P

  • Norton’s stance: Norton VPN supports P2P/torrenting on specific servers designed for P2P traffic. You’ll want to choose those servers to get better speeds and reliability.
  • How to find P2P-optimized servers: In the Norton app, there’s typically a list or map of servers; look for explicit “P2P,” “Torrent,” or “Dedicated P2P” tags. If you don’t see it, that server isn’t optimized for torrenting.
  • Encryption and protocols: Norton VPN uses strong encryption and supports common protocols. For torrenting, you’ll usually want OpenVPN or WireGuard, depending on what Norton offers in your region.
  • Kill switch and DNS protection: Norton VPN includes a kill switch to prevent leaks if the VPN drops, and DNS/IPv6 leak protection to keep your real address hidden from peers.
  • Logging policy: Norton VPN has a privacy policy that outlines what data is collected. Generally, VPNs that offer P2P on some servers still log minimal data, but you should review the latest policy for specifics.
  • Legal considerations: Torrenting copyrighted content can be illegal in many jurisdictions. A VPN does not grant immunity from law enforcement or copyright enforcement actions.

Section: Step-by-step guide: torrenting with Norton VPN

  • Step 1: Confirm P2P support on a server
    • Open Norton VPN app
    • Browse servers for a P2P, Torrent, or P2P Optimized label
    • Connect to a P2P-enabled server
  • Step 2: Enable security features
    • Turn on the kill switch
    • Ensure DNS protection is enabled
    • Use the TCP/UDP port recommended by Norton for P2P if shown
  • Step 3: Configure your torrent client
    • Use a reputable client qBittorrent, Deluge, μTorrent, etc.
    • In the client’s settings, enable encrypted connections if available
    • Bind the client to a local port if your router allows port forward/port mapping
  • Step 4: Optimize torrent settings for privacy and speed
    • Seed with a reasonable ratio; avoid excessive port exposure on public trackers
    • Disable DHT if you want tighter control though it can affect swarm health
    • Consider using a private tracker with a VPN where allowed
  • Step 5: Test for leaks
    • After starting a torrent, use a site likeiple or do a quick check to ensure your real IP isn’t leaking
    • Verify IPv4 and IPv6 addresses are not exposing your identity
  • Step 6: Monitor performance
    • Check speeds and don’t block VPN due to strict firewall rules
    • If speeds drop, try a different P2P server or switch to a different protocol supported by Norton
  • Step 7: Stay compliant
    • Only torrent legal content or content you own
    • Respect copyright laws in your jurisdiction
    • Avoid uploading or sharing infringing files on public trackers

Section: Technical tips and best practices

  • DNS and IPv6 protection: Always enable to close leaks.
  • Port forwarding and NAT: If your torrent client needs inbound connections, ensure your router allows the necessary ports; many VPNs avoid port forwarding due to shared IPs.
  • Protocol choice: If Norton offers WireGuard, it’s typically faster and more reliable for P2P than older protocols.
  • Separate devices for torrenting: Consider a dedicated device if you routinely torrent large files, to minimize potential exposure on your main devices.
  • Regular privacy checks: Run leak tests after every major Norton VPN update or change of server.

FAQ: Additional considerations

  • Does Norton VPN support WireGuard for faster P2P? Availability varies by region; newer protocols like WireGuard are often faster and more efficient for P2P traffic when offered.
  • Can I torrent over IPv6 with Norton VPN? If you enable IPv6 protection, you can reduce leak risk, but some VPNs don’t route IPv6 well for P2P. Disable IPv6 in the torrent client if necessary.
  • Is there a risk of copyright notices when using a VPN? A VPN doesn’t remove the risk of copyright infringement; you should avoid infringing content and comply with local laws.
  • What happens if Norton VPN disconnects during a torrent? The kill switch should block all traffic, preventing leaks. It’s important to test and confirm this behavior.
